How to remove an ad account shared by a Business Center partner

Admins in Business Center can remove ad accounts shared by partners at any time. Ad accounts can be removed for reasons like the completion of a collaboration or a change in business needs.


Before you begin

  • Ensure you are an Admin for the current Business Center.

  • Ensure you have at least one ad account shared by a Business Center partner.


How to remove an ad account shared by a Business Center partner

  1. Log in to your TikTok Business Center account.

  2. On the left side menu, click Partners.

  3. Click the partner who shared the ad account with you.

    Your navigation will vary depending on your Business Center type and how your partners are organized:

    • Direct Business Center: Select the partner directly from the partner list.

    • Agency Business Center: The steps to find your partner depending on how your partners are organized:

      • If all your partners are organized by Company, click View details in the Action column for the relevant Company, then select the Direct Business Center.

      • If all your partners are not organized by Company, select the Direct Business Center from the Business Center list.

      • If you have a mix, your Partner page will have two tabs: Companies and Other accounts. Navigate to the correct tab to find and select the partner.

  4. In the Shared with you tab, find the ad account you want to remove.

  5. Click the external link icon in the Actions column for the ad account to go to the ad account page.

  6. Click the ad account name to open the account details page.

  7. In the top right corner of the ad account details page, click Delete.

  8. Click Confirm.


Once an ad account shared by a partner is removed from the TikTok Business Center, all assets linked to it will be unlinked, and any media agency partnerships will also end.
